    A computer for ADHD and Visual Snow Syndrome?

    |
    |
    Posted . Owned for 1 year when reviewed.
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    This computer is my daily driver and I use it for school. It's my baby. I'm light sensitive + am prone to eyestrain (I have Visual Snow Syndrome), yet I experience almost no eye strain with this computer, or other zenbooks, probably having to do with the glossy Oled display. My eyes do get fatigued when the colors are set to Vivid in the driver settings, but I went in and changed the colors to web standard or something like that and I have no problems. I notice fine details that most people wouldn't, so screens with low PPI drive me nuts (and also give me eye strain), but I feel like this display is beautiful and I can read for long periods of time without having problems. The large screen also helps me focus. I also have ADHD so I try to bring beauty into whatever it is I'm working on in order to stay focused, and this computer does that. The caraluminum is a fun texture that I love to touch, same with the aluminum body. The keys are soft and make a nice sound, the touch screen is also soft, and like I said, the display is lovely. It's pretty so it keeps my attention longer. THIS COMPUTER DOES GET HOT!!! That is its achilles heel. To me, I just see it as something that can be worked around. I'm at one year of use and so far it's not an issue that's so big that it disrupts its function. However, if I plug it in while I'm doing any kind of demanding task, sometimes even watching a video, it can get quite hot and the fans start blowing. Sometimes I'll plug it in for a bit, and when it gets too hot, I'll unplug it for a bit, wait, then plug it back in. I don't have this problem if it's plugged in while asleep or off, it's just when I'm using it. Its battery life is reliable and it charges quickly so I don't experience its getting hot while charging as a huge issue. That being said, I feel like you do have to be careful with it around this problem. This computer gets a lot of flack but honestly I personally love it and it fits all of my very niche needs. It's the only computer I've come across that actually fits those needs, so its flaws are a tradeoff I don't have a problem making. It you want a lightweight 16 inch computer with beautiful aesthetics, a screen that is gentle on the eyes, fast performance, and reliable battery life, then this is for you, if you don't mind the fact that it does get hot when plugged in. If youre using it for schoolwork, reading, videos, and light video editing, then I recommend it. If youre looking for a dedicated gaming computer, then I can't recommend this one, unless youre playing something light like Stardew Valley or Undertale.

    Zenbook not totally Zen

    |
    |
    Posted . Owned for 1 month when reviewed.
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    Upside: The screen size is a full 16 inches. The processor works great and is very fast in the Windows 11 environment. Hopefully this will allow a Windows 12 upgrade. The salesperson didn't really say. Otherwise, Windows updates were made very quickly. The keyboard returns me to the regular QWERTY keyboard without the extended number keypad on the right, which I've never needed. So far sound is great and the colors are fantastic. Downside: There are very few ports: only one USB 3.x (on the right side) and two USB-C (on the left side), making it necessary to purchase a hub for using external hard drives and printers at the same time, both of which are USB 3.0. Best Buy had only one hub in stock at the store, very limited. I had to go to other retailers for my new peripherals. Also the power cord uses one of the USB-C ports rather than having a stand alone power input (similar to headphone jack) that my previous ASUS laptop utilized. Not a very smart design as far as ports are concerned. The touch pad has a limited sweet spot when right and left clicking, but I prefer using a mouse which is much quicker anyway, thus use of an external port is necessary, but I can use the touch pad when necessary. The screen dims pretty quickly when it is on battery and haven't had a chance to work with the settings on this yet. There isn't a "Home" and "End" key on the keyboard. The page up, down, home and end works to move the cursor up, down, left and right, but to use as true page up, down, home and end you press the Fn (function key) on the bottom left while pressing the appropriate Home/End etc. key on the right. I don't like the position of the power "ON" button on the upper right next to the Delete key. They could have placed this button somewhere else on the keyboard or on the side of the Zenbook like my previous ASUS laptop.

    I want to love it, but it has too many issues

    |
    |
    Posted . Owned for 2 months when reviewed.
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    Overall right now how the laptop is alright. I want to say it's great since I saw reviews and there were a lot of good things to say about it, but after returning it 3x I can't say that. Cons: I replaced this laptop 3x times since each one has had some kind of issue with it. Replacement #1 - After getting it all setup I immediately noticed that when I would watch videos the screen would randomly go black for about a second and then back to normal. There was also one point where it was downloading an update and after it got a blue screen. I knew a brand new $1,400 laptop should not be having these kind of issues on day 1 so I returned it. Replacement #2 - After setting up this one I didn’t have the screen issues from before, but for some reason, the right fan was really loud. It would be running up a lot faster than the left one and had a really annoying whirring sound. It sounded as if there was a screw loose inside and so was moving on its own. I tried opening it to see if I could fix it, but 2 of the screws on the backplate were on there really tight. I got frustrated that again this $1,400 laptop had another issue so I returned it. Replacement #3 (Current) - Now I am currently using the 3rd replacement and it's been 2 months. The fan issues seem to be fixed with this one. I haven’t gotten a blue screen. However: Screen: I got a different kind of screen issue from the 1st replacement. Now when I watch am using the laptop either on websites or videos I will get a random 1-inch black bar across my screen wherever my mouse it located. It pops up for a second, but it feels like the laptop will just shut down at any moment. Power: (Not sure if this is related to the above issue with the screen.) Sometimes the laptop just won’t turn on. It would have a charge, but when I turn it on the keyboard lights up like always, but the screen remains black. I wait a few minutes and it still doesn’t turn on. Only until I do a hard reset by holding the power button for 10 seconds and turning it on again does it turn on. This happens about 1-2x a week. Trackpad: The trackpad will just randomly stop wanting to work. I will be doing something and the trackpad will stop moving. Even the mouse disappears. Then after a minute it comes back, but becomes crazy sensitive and unusable. I have to turn off and on the laptop to fix it or wait like 5 minutes to go back to normal since sometimes I am working on I can’t turn it off or I’ll lose my info. General complaints: Keyboard - At least on the white version it's hard to see the secondary functions on the number row. As in the @, #,$, %, and those other signs when using the backlight. I have to look over on top of the keyboard to see what I’m clicking on. Heat: There will be times that the laptop will be warm and the fans will turn on. Even right now as I am writing this I am on 54% battery not plugged in, I have one window open with 12 tabs and the fans are on and the back is warm. Looking at the My Asus app I can see that the right find is always running faster than the left one. Sometimes it gets really loud where I have to try and cool the laptop down by hovering it above my desk for a few seconds. It seems like the cooling solution in this laptop isn’t very good or the chip is drawing too much power. Or both. Battery: The battery isn’t as good as I thought it’d be. It lasts me about 8 hours just browsing the internet and watching videos. I was expecting at least 10 hours. Pros: Design - I love the design with how nice it looks. I wanted to get the higher ram option but the white is only available in this lower ram config. Speed: It's been pretty fast and I expected that since I also wanted the new AMD zen 5 chips. It can handle the 5 windows and 20 tabs each I have open on it. Display: Very nice display with the colors and the touch capability. Trackpad: It would've been nice if it was a haptic trackpad, but it still feels good. It's big and centered so it doesn't hurt my wrist as much as my HP Spectre x360 that I replaced. I think the left and right slide of controlling the volume and brightness is interesting but not too helpful since there are buttons for that already. Keyboard: The keyboard feels good and responsive. Since this is the laptop that has had the least amount of issues I am keeping it since I really want to like it and I believe all the issues I am experiencing now are software-based and not hardware ( but I could be wrong on that). However, I am debating about buying from Asus again. This is my first time buying anything from them and I am more frustrated than happy with these purchases. I hope they can get better quality control in the future and can get their software in order.

    2 Months Later

    |
    |
    Posted . Owned for 1 month when reviewed.
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    I'm thoroughly impressed with this laptop. I got it after my other laptop was starting to give out and I needed better specs and a touchscreen. My last laptop was an HP 2 in 1 and it couldn't run very many things and was extremely heavy. This laptop keeps up with everything that I'm running, charges incredibly quickly, and is thin and light. I'm a STEM student and an education student, so I need to be able to take notes on my laptop, often handwritten. I was a bit nervous about how well the screen would be able to handle a pen, but it honestly is better than my old 2 in 1 laptop on that front. Because of my majors and my hobbies, I use my laptop for everything, from writing long papers, playing movies and games, running simulations, rendering, drawing, browsing, coding, etc. I haven't noticed any issue with any of this. Obviously the hinges don't flip the whole way back like my 2 in 1, which was my biggest worry when getting the laptop since I take a lot of handwritten notes and render drawings—however, the hinges are sturdy and the screen is responsive enough to where I feel I need tablet mode, so I haven't really missed having that feature. The screen is absolutely stunning. I didn't buy this laptop for the screen, but it's definitely the cherry on top. The colors are vivid, the resolution is high, and the refresh rate is delightful. The keyboard and the touchpad are excellent quality. There's no rattling or drift, and the touchpad even has a feature that allows you to adjust the volume and brightness. I have to write a ton of papers and put in a lot of equations in programs, and my past laptops have annoyed me to no end with a touchpad that rattles or keys that are slightly off center. This laptop has neither issue. I personally haven't had any issues with the heat. Even when I'm running games (which the laptop does well, obviously it can't run new games on max graphics, but I can still play new games on lower graphics which I wasn't expecting from a work laptop), the laptop gets warm, but I haven't noticed it throttle itself yet. Overall, I'm extremely happy with it. I was devastated that my last laptop broke and decided to get better specs on my next laptop to avoid that. I'm a college student. I don't want to have to drop over a thousand dollars on a laptop, but I also don't want to have to throw my laptop through the wall because it can barely run chrome and Microsoft Teams at the same time like my last laptop. Am I extremely broke now? Yes. Was it so worth it? Also yes. Coming from someone who doesn't have a lot of money to spare, the price is more than reasonable.
